32 Neville Street, Norwich, NR2 2PR is a freehold terraced property built between 1900-1929. The property offers approximately 936 square feet of living space. In this location, properties of similar size usually have three bedrooms.

The estimated current market value of the property is £412,824 , which equates to approximately £441 per square foot. It was last sold on 26 Mar 2004 for £185,000. Since then, the value has increased by £227,824, representing a 123.1% increase, or approximately 5.7% per year.

The current estimated value of £412,824 is:

  • 20.9% higher than the average property price on Neville Street
  • 23.0% higher than the average in the NR2 2PR postcode area
  • and 38.0% higher than the average price for Norwich as a whole

At the most recent EPC inspection on 20 June 2023, the property was recorded as rented.

32 Neville Street, Norwich, Norfolk, NR2 2PR has an Energy Performance Certificate (EPC) rating of D, based on the latest assessment carried out on 20 Jun 2023.

This property uses a gas-fired boiler and radiators, connected to the mains gas supply, as its main heating source. Hot water is provided from main heating system. The windows have partial double glazing.

The previous EPC assessment was conducted on 2 May 2013. The rating of D remains the same, but the energy efficiency score improved by 10.3%.

Since the previous assessment, several changes were observed:

  • The lighting was updated from low energy lighting in 36% of fixed outlets to low energy lighting in all fixed outlets, with efficiency improving from average to very good.
